Output 42c529633442989f5481da61a9017165a134ac7339e960545013a98c879f21ad:70

value
173720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8259cf5a033d1ab772109b3e52f014cac569d8 OP_EQUAL
address
3Jy3njVe7faLHYBGwmiojtLca6NsPatZcc
transaction
42c529633442989f5481da61a9017165a134ac7339e960545013a98c879f21ad
spent
true